Screw or Rivet Mount Cable Tie Mounts are applied by an easy screw fastener and give maximum stability to a wire bundle. The harness version will allow for multiple cable ties or a wider cable tie
Heavy-Duty Screw-On Vibration Mounts absorb shock and reduce noise with high adhesion to the floor. These mounts are ideal for use as feet on machinery and conveyors
Rubber Standoffs, also known as Quiet Mounts or Vibration Damping Standoffs, absorb vibration. These Anti Vibration Standoffs also soap up noise and shock.
A Rubber Standoff is suitable for applications where movement in stationary machinery is unavoidable, such as on washing machines or conveyors. These Rubber Standoff Spacers are ideal for heavy duty applications.
Metal Leaf Hinges are available for applications for flush-mounted doors with countersunk mounting holes. The range of Die-Cast Zinc Alloy hinges have a maximum rotation of 270 degrees and there are a number of types available. We also offer ranges in Premium, Round and Square Stainless Steel Hinges. The range of Flat Hinges operate with Stainless Steel Pin and come in either Steel with a Black Coated Finish or in Die-Cast Zinc Alloy and Delrin Bearing. The Steel hinges offer a very strong tamperproof hinge on a 270 degree rotational angle and is supplied with M8 x 12mm fasteners. The Zinc hinge is on a 180 degree rotational angle.
Recessed Screw Mount Handles can be mounted flush to a door or panel with mounting studs. The flush mount is ideal for areas where a protruding handle would inhibit functionality or in limited space.
Lift-Off Screw Mount Hinges are easy lift-off function. They come in stainless steel and steel with either a zinc-plated or black powder coated finish. They have an hinge rotation angle of 180 degree. The design is drilled to be screwed to the frame.
Metal Leaf Hinges are available for applications for flush-mounted doors with threaded stud installations. The range of Die-Cast Zinc Alloy hinges have a maximum rotation of 270 degrees and there are a number of types available all in either a Chrome-Plated or Black Powder Coated Finish
Metal Pull Handles are designed to be mounted on drawers, cabinets, and other types of furniture; they can also be welded or screw-mounted. It features a flanged right-angle design, which offers a secure grip and a sleek appearance.
 It is easy to install and remove using equipment or tools. Their material makes them durable and long-lasting, and shock-resistant.
Side Hinges offer a rotational angle of 180 degrees. Types 1 and 2 are high resistance hinges for medium and heavy door panels. They also offer high security and are assembled using the special screws provided. Type 3 is a lower cost, lower security alternative.
Metal Leaf Hinges are available for applications for flush-mounted doors with half countersunk mounting holes on one side of the component and half- threaded studs on the other. The range of Die-Cast Zinc Alloy hinges have a maximum rotation of 270 degrees and there are a number of types available.
Teflon Glides are fastened with the aid of a screw to provide a strong hold to the mounting surface. A 4.5 mm diameter hole provides a fastener entry for the screw without damaging the washer. The steel washer is coated with PTFE to provide maximum glide.
Handle Turn Cam Latches feature an T-shaped handle. They are commonly used cabinet and furniture applications.
The cam latches compression allows for a more secure seal where IP/NEMA performance is required. This also allows for improved insulation against noise and vibration conditions.
With locking and non-locking options to choose, you are sure to find a solution for your application.
Compression Latches that feature a wide grip range with adjustable screw. The latch provides good compression and is available in a choice of pre-set compression options that include; 4mm and 6mm for improved noise isolation.
The latch has noise dampening properties and offers better sealing under vibration and shock conditions. The latch is rated per DIN-EN 61373.
The range features latches with a quarter turn cam operation and a choice of locking and non-locking options. Cams and driver keys are sold separately.
A range of Replacement and Alternative Steel Cams are available for our range of Locks. The Replacement Cams are suitable for all standard quarter turns and cam locks. They provide an alternative grip range is used with pre-assembled locks. Cams in this range are additional and all locks throughout the range are provided with the cam stated for each range. There are 2 types of Alternative Steel Cams available. Type 1 is to fit parts 492878 through to 492882 and are zinc-plated to prevent corrosion. The cranks cams are used to increase or decrease the effective length of the cam lock. Part 492895 has both a vertical and horizontal hole to allow fitting at all four quarter hour positions. Type 2 offers the same properties as type 1 but is to fit parts 492883 through to 492890
The sprung cam lifts and returns when the door is closed. As the panel door is pushed to, the cam rises and then springs down behind the panel wall.
Slam Action Slide Latches work with a spring system to lock and release. It is compatible with two different type of striker.
Steel clamps with rubber cushion is available to buy at Essentra. P clamp is made from cold rolled steel that is zinc electroplated, offering excellec oxidation.
This cushioned p clamp provides electrical insulation and vibration absorption, and is ideal for long-life applications.
Mini Adjustable Compression Latches are IP65 rated and are made from Black Die-Cast Zinc. They offer a 4mm compression and are supplied with a sealing gasket. They allow for a simple adjustment of the grip range and are ideal for applications with a limited space. The keys that are compatible are sold separately
